Contextual inquiry is a research technique that allows researchers to explore and understand the real-world context in which a product or service is used. By directly observing users and collecting data on their needs, goals, and behaviors, contextual inquiry provides valuable insights for the design and improvement of products and services.

Considerations and Challenges

While leveraging the power of Gemini in contextual inquiry brings numerous benefits, it is crucial to acknowledge certain considerations and challenges:

Data Bias:

As with any AI technology, biases in training data can affect the accuracy and reliability of Gemini's responses. Researchers need to be cautious of potential biases and validate the generated data against real-world user feedback and experiences.

Ethical Usage:

Responsible usage of AI technologies like Gemini is essential. Researchers must ensure that participants are fully aware of the AI-assisted process and obtain their consent for data collection and analysis. Transparency in the usage of AI and maintaining participant privacy should be paramount.

User-Centered Design:

While Gemini brings convenience and efficiency to the contextual inquiry process, it should not overshadow the core principles of user-centered design. Researchers should continue to prioritize user empathy, understanding, and collaboration, utilizing Gemini as a tool to enhance, not replace, human interaction.
